I had this beer on-tap in a schooner at the brewery. The version I drank was 6.7% ABV.
Appearance: murky yellow-gold hue with a finger of frothy white foam. Not bad, and given that this is a wheat-based IPA, not at all unexpected.
Smell: lightly sweet with a nice hop character of tropical fruits and a dash of minty herbalness. I like it.
Taste: smooth tropical fruitiness along with a more bracing herbal/piney character. Not at all bad.
Mouthfeel: medium body with a good carbonation and a huge smoothness. Love it.
Overall: super smooth body but the bitterness is not quite as smooth. Still, a decent quaff.
